Application

Operating Voltage 6.0~8.4V DC
No Load Current ≤350 mA at 7.4V
Rated Torque 8kgf.cm at 7.4V
Stall Current ≤12A  at 7.4V
Stall Torque ≥45 kgf.cm at 7.4V;≥25 kgf.cm at 7.4V
Operating Travel Angle 180°±10°(500→2500μs)
Mechanical Limit Angle 360°
Angle deviation ≤ 1°
Weight 91.5±2.0g
Case Material Aluminum alloy
Gear Set Material Metal Gear
Motor Type Brushless  motor
